D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ES: The Graphics Designer Is responsible supporting the design and development of student books, teachers guide, and other teaching and learning aids. S/he is responsible for contributing towards design solutions that have a high visual impact. The role involves listening to RTI staff and collaborating with Sketch Artists, Illustrators, Copy Editors and stakeholders to understand their needs before making design decisions. The job function includes, but is not limited to the following responsibilities:
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S:
Thinking creatively to produce new ideas and concepts.
Interpreting READ TA graphics needs and developing designs to suit their purpose.
Creating designs, concepts, and sample layouts based on knowledge of layout principles and esthetic design concepts.
Drawing and printing charts, graphs, illustrations, and other artwork, using computer
Proofreading to produce accurate and high-quality work
Marking up, pasting, and assembling final layouts to prepare layouts for printer
Working with a wide range of media and emerging technologies, including photography, Illustrator, Photoshop, Acrobat, Adobe InDesign
Determining size and arrangement of illustrative material and copy, and selecting style and size of type
Submitting finished copy and art layout for approval
Contributing to a team effort by accomplishing related results as needed
Job Requirement
QUALIFICATIONS: • Relevant bachelor degree including, Art/fine art, Communication design, Media arts, Print and digital media management and Visual communication and design or relevant certificate or diploma in graphics design • Proven competence in desktop publishing tools, design and image processing software, i.e., Photoshop, Illustrator and InDesign automation • Two to five years of experience as a graphic designer in a major publishing outlet with demonstrated experience in layout and creative services including color separation • Accuracy and attention to detail • Fluency in both written and spoken English is required • Fluency in one or more READ TA Mother Tongue Languages is an asset
